Filecoin surges 12.45% to $1.454 today

Filecoin (FIL) is currently trading at $1.454, placing it above the MA-20 ($1.29945) but below the MA-50 ($1.51742) and well under the MA-200 ($2.08616). This setup indicates that short-term momentum is positive, though medium- and long-term trends remain bearish, with the nearest resistance at the MA-50 and dynamic support provided by the Ichimoku Kijun level at $1.378.

Highlights

  • Filecoin is preparing to launch its Onchain Cloud mainnet in January 2026, adding programmable storage and retrieval and targeting AI infrastructure growth.
  • Sharp increases in Filecoin (FIL) trading volume and declining FIL balances on exchanges indicate a shifting market structure in anticipation of the new mainnet.
  • Despite market activity, total value locked in Filecoin-based DeFi remains modest, signaling muted adoption of its decentralized financial services to date.

Trading volume surges as Onchain Cloud launch shifts market structure

Recent activity in Filecoin is closely linked to anticipation around the upcoming launch of its Onchain Cloud mainnet, set for January 2026, which is expected to expand the platform's role to include programmable storage and retrieval services. This initiative highlights Filecoin's ambition to serve as core infrastructure for AI data pipelines and aligns it with the Decentralized Physical Infrastructure (DePIN) trend. Additionally, a sharp increase in trading volume and declining FIL balances on exchanges point to changing market structure, though total value locked in Filecoin-based DeFi remains modest.

Overbought signals diverge from weak momentum amid high volatility

Technical indicators on the daily chart deliver mixed signals: the ADX remains weak and neutral, while the MACD signals strong selling pressure. However, oscillators like RSI (57.6), Stoch RSI (100), and CCI (253) all suggest overbought conditions, hinting at potential exhaustion. Bull/Bear Power shows that buyers dominated intraday as FIL rallied 12.45% with a gap up and high volatility, closing near the lower end of the day’s range. These conflicting signals underline notable short-term divergence — intraday bullishness is not fully corroborated by underlying momentum indicators, warranting a cautious approach.

Sideways consolidation expected as upside faces technical barriers

In the coming five sessions, FIL is expected to trade in a price range between $1.32 and $1.65, reflecting typical volatility around current levels. Weekly trends imply less than a 20% chance of a sustained upward move, making renewed declines the more probable scenario. The base case is for FIL to consolidate sideways within the $1.32 to $1.65 band. A break above the MA-50 could trigger further upside above $1.65, whereas a drop below $1.32 would reinforce bearish momentum and open the door to additional downside.

Viktoras Karapetjanc, expert at Traders Union, sees Filecoin trading in a constructive range as excitement builds for its Onchain Cloud launch in 2026. He notes fundamental strength in Filecoin’s DePIN ambitions and rising demand, despite technical signals showing mixed momentum and overbought signs. The analyst believes consolidation between $1.32 and $1.65 is likely, with further upside depending on a break above the MA-50. In his words: "Short-term momentum is bright, but confirmation above $1.65 is needed for a firmer bullish outlook."
